Everytime I browse the files that are in my memory card of my pocketPC phone the windows explorer behavior is odd.

For example - when i click on a picture (locatsed on my card) i don't see it, it just shows a property screen insted.

Another example is when i copy files from pocket-pc to pc i dont see the files on my pc (the other way around works)

anyone know why is that?

This is the default behavior if you're browsing files in the PPC with Activesync. Use WM5Storage to turn your PPC into a flash drive and then browsing will be normal.

Yes. In that case uninstall WM5Storage and us that option to turn your PPC into a flash drive for PC. By the way, using WM5Storage you can switch between Activesync connection and USB Storage , the same as with that option provided in your ROM. The point is your PPC can eoither be flash drive or a PPC (Activesync, etc.) but not both at the same time.
Another thing you might want to check is that Windows sometimes doesn't assign a drive letter to a new flash, so you must go into CONTROL PANEL-ADMINISTRATIVE TOOLS-COMPUTER MANAGEMENT-DISK MANAGEMENT and manually assign an unused letter to that flash drive. This happens to me often.
